No. MINI electric or plug-in hybrid vehicles do not currently support bidirectional charging. The bidirectional charging capability enables electric vehicles to not only absorb electrical energy for the high-voltage battery when connected to a compatible charging station or Wallbox, but also to feed it back into the power grid in the reverse direction. Electric vehicles thus become mobile energy storage devices that can also release electricity if required.
